Just because they are new plugs, don't assume they are all good. Years ago I swapped out the distributor and installed new plugs on a Series. I spent hours figuring I'd messed up the distributor, until out of desperation I did some testing and found 3 of the 4 plugs were bad. No wonder it would barely run!
Also make sure you have all the wires going to the correct plugs and all the new wires are good. You didn't get any gasoline on the dist cap did you? The high carbon content of gasoline can make the bakelite electrically conductive. You might want to look around and make sure you didn't knock loose any vacumn lines.
